A Maseno University student was on Monday morning shot dead during an Anti-government protest within the area that saw six police officers injured.

The third-year student was hit on the neck around 5 pm. The student had joined other Azimio la Umoja demonstrators following the call by its leader.

According to a police report, during the protests, they invaded the Sairam supermarket, in Maseno town and other business premises along Kisumu-Busia road.

The report further indicated that they went ahead and lit bonfires and barricaded stones along the road.

"After some time, the students started pelting stones at the police line where they damaged window panes in ten houses and the police station", it read in parts.

It further indicated that the protestors overpowered the officers who were manning the station after the officers ran out of teargas canisters and blanks.

The report stated that six police officers were injured during the skirmishes.

"This prompted the officers who had been sent out to quell the intruders to fire live bullets. Consequently, the 3rd year student was hit on the neck", the police report read.

He was rushed to Coptic Hospital where was pronounced dead on arrival.
